Skales Reveals He Wrote Hit Songs for Wizkid

Nigerian singer Raoul John Njeng-Njeng, popularly known as Skales, has revealed that he wrote several hit songs for his former label mate Wizkid during their time at Empire Mates Entertainment (EME).

Speaking on the podcast ‘Curiosity Made Me Ask’ hosted by content creator Bae U Barbie, Skales shared that he contributed to some tracks on Wizkid’s debut album Super Star, including the bonus track “Wiz Party.”

He also acknowledged that their collaboration was mutual, with Wizkid writing songs for him as well. One notable track Wizkid penned for Skales was the hit single “Mukulu.”

“Back in EME, we worked as a team, writing songs for each other,” Skales explained. “I wrote some of Wizkid’s songs, and he did the same for me. He wrote ‘Mukulu’ for me, and I wrote ‘Wiz Party’ for him. It was all about teamwork back then.”

Both him and Wizkid were among the first artists signed to EME by singer and music executive Banky W in the early 2010s.

Their time with the label helped launch their careers into the limelight, but they eventually parted ways following a series of disagreements with Banky W.

In a previous interview with Ebuka Obi-Uchendu, Banky W disclosed that Wizkid was contractually obligated to deliver three more albums to EME before leaving the label.
